Third Annual CIC Gala Dinner

Each fall, the Annual CIC Gala Dinner highlights an issue of major importance for Canada and for the global community. The dinner brings together members of Canada's business, academic, media and policy communities to honour a distinguished global figure with the CIC Globalist of the Year Award. Proceeds from the Annual CIC Gala Dinner go towards funding CIC research programs, which enhances Canada’s contribution to international development and Canadian policy priorities.

Mr. Jim Balsillie and Mr. Peter Munk hosted the Third Annual CIC Gala Dinner on Tuesday, November 3, 2009 at the Four Seasons Hotel in Toronto. This year’s theme focused on the economic crisis, with particular emphasis on its worrying implications for the stability of an open international trading system, vital for a sustained economic recovery. Mr. Pascal Lamy, recently elected to a second term as Director-General of the World Trade Organization, was the recipient of the 2009 CIC Globalist of the Year Award.
